Explore the latest trends and statistics in the aviation industry.
Master browser compatibility with our expert tips! Navigate the digital jungle and ensure your website shines everywhere. Click to learn more!
In today's digital landscape, ensuring browser compatibility is crucial for delivering smooth web experiences. Each browser interprets HTML, CSS, and JavaScript differently, which can lead to discrepancies in how your website appears and functions across various platforms. To tackle these challenges, web developers must prioritize testing on multiple browsers, including Chrome, Firefox, Safari, and Edge. Additionally, utilizing feature detection libraries like Modernizr can help identify which features are supported in a user's browser, thereby enhancing their experience.
To achieve optimal browser compatibility, consider following these essential best practices:
When developing websites, browser compatibility issues can disrupt user experience and accessibility. One of the most common problems is inconsistent CSS rendering. Different browsers may interpret CSS styles in various ways, leading to layout shifts or design inconsistencies. To address this, it's essential to utilize CSS reset or normalize stylesheets to minimize differences across browsers. Additionally, testing across multiple browsers and their respective versions during the development phase can significantly reduce these inconsistencies.
Another frequent issue is JavaScript compatibility. Certain JavaScript features may work flawlessly in one browser but fail in another due to different levels of support. To solve this problem, developers should implement feature detection libraries, such as Modernizr, which can identify whether a browser supports specific functionalities. Furthermore, using polyfills can help to provide fallback solutions for unsupported features, ensuring that all users have a consistent experience, regardless of their browser choice.
In today's digital landscape, ensuring your website is ready for everyone means testing for cross-browser compatibility. Different web browsers can render websites in various ways due to differences in their rendering engines. This can lead to significant discrepancies in how your site appears and functions for users across platforms like Chrome, Firefox, Safari, and Edge. To guarantee an optimal experience for all visitors, use a comprehensive approach that includes:
Moreover, cross-browser compatibility testing is not just about aesthetics; it also impacts functionality. For instance, JavaScript code may behave differently, leading to broken features or interactive elements not working as intended. It is crucial to prioritize compatibility testing during the development phase and routinely afterward. Make sure to pay attention to:
By taking these proactive measures, you can ensure that your website is inclusive, reaching its full potential in engaging a diverse audience.